What Is a Chemical Peel and How Does It Work?
A chemical peel is a skin-resurfacing treatment that involves applying a solution made of safe acids to the skin’s surface. This solution exfoliates the outermost layer of dead skin cells, encouraging new cell turnover. As the damaged layer sheds, clearer and healthier skin is revealed underneath.
Peels vary in strength—ranging from light surface-level exfoliation to deeper treatments for more serious concerns. No matter your skin type, there’s a peel suited to your needs.
Top Benefits of Chemical Peels for Your Skin
Let’s break down the major chemical peel benefits for skin in Dubai and why this treatment is so popular:
✅ 1. Brightens Dull, Tired Skin
Environmental stress, sun exposure, and lifestyle factors can leave your skin looking flat and lifeless. A chemical peel sloughs off that dull top layer, restoring radiance and a healthy glow in just one session.
✅ 2. Fades Hyperpigmentation and Dark Spots
Whether you’re dealing with sunspots, melasma, or acne-related discoloration, peels target uneven skin tone at the source. Over a few sessions, you’ll notice a clearer, more balanced complexion.
✅ 3. Improves Skin Texture and Smoothness
Rough patches, bumpy skin, and flaky areas are gently refined through chemical exfoliation. This treatment helps resurface the skin, reducing imperfections and leaving a soft, even finish.
✅ 4. Reduces Fine Lines and Wrinkles
Mild to moderate signs of aging—such as crow’s feet, smile lines, or forehead creases—can be minimized with the right peel. Stimulating new skin cell growth encourages a smoother, firmer texture.
✅ 5. Clears Acne and Prevents Future Breakouts
Salicylic acid and mandelic acid peels are especially beneficial for acne-prone skin. They penetrate deep into the pores, clearing oil buildup, reducing inflammation, and preventing new breakouts from forming.
✅ 6. Boosts Collagen Production
Some medium to deep peels stimulate collagen and elastin production, helping maintain skin’s elasticity. This leads to firmer, more youthful skin over time, especially when done in a treatment series.
✅ 7. Minimizes the Appearance of Pores
If enlarged pores are a concern, chemical peels help unclog them and refine their appearance. The result is a smoother, more polished look that allows makeup to glide on effortlessly.
✅ 8. Enhances Product Absorption
Once the top layer of dead skin is removed, your serums and moisturizers can penetrate deeper and work more effectively. This makes your entire skincare routine more efficient.
Types of Peels Based on Your Skin Needs
Depending on your goals, the right chemical peel will be selected:
Glycolic acid peels for glow and anti-aging
Salicylic acid peels for acne and clogged pores
Lactic acid peels for sensitive, dry skin
TCA peels for deeper pigmentation and texture issues
Each peel works differently, and your skincare expert will tailor the treatment for your unique skin profile.

Aftercare Tips to Maximize Results
To enjoy long-lasting chemical peel benefits for skin in Dubai, it’s important to follow proper aftercare:
Use a gentle cleanser and avoid scrubbing
Keep your skin moisturized
Avoid sun exposure and always use SPF 30+
Don’t pick at peeling skin
Skip makeup for at least 24 hours
Avoid active ingredients like retinol for several days
These tips help your skin heal properly and maintain that fresh post-peel glow.
How Often Should You Get a Peel?
Light peels can be done every 3–4 weeks, while deeper peels require more time between sessions. Many clients incorporate peels into their monthly skincare routine for ongoing results.
Your skincare specialist will create a schedule based on your skin type and treatment goals.
